Transaction d159d391a52f6273619f4975ec1385fe2aff1433c31231a361c1bedbb99e6599
1 Input
1 Output
-
d159d391a52f6273619f4975ec1385fe2aff1433c31231a361c1bedbb99e6599:0
- value
- 28269
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6644107ff341ee86f6ecd3620fa17b2ced81ce42 OP_EQUAL
- address
- 3B1kPK2C4DT72VEZN7bU1ei7uZXmA53yxc